The George Street Patsy's - Dunedin's Wooden Band

Description

In the beginning of early 2002 a plan was hatched by Graeme Peters and Matt Langley to put an acoustic duo together and play a few gigs.

They also busked on George Street for the odd bit of coin. This lasted a month or two and then they got all carried away and hooked Paul Southworth in to play some bass. Next was the addition of drummer Jake Langley.

The band was now complete, after quickly putting a plan in place for world domination The George Street Patsy's got a gig at the Taieri AMP show. "This may not have been our best gig but we did see an Alpaca spontaneously combust" said Graeme. With a southerly front going through delivering torrential rain and hardship, The GSP's managed to at least get a couple of cowboys to say "Good on ya blokes" and give a luke warm round of applause.
